summaryrefslogtreecommitdiffstats
path: root/testasmcomp
diff options
context:
space:
mode:
Diffstat (limited to 'testasmcomp')
-rw-r--r--testasmcomp/Makefile1
-rw-r--r--testasmcomp/alpha.asm5
2 files changed, 2 insertions, 4 deletions
diff --git a/testasmcomp/Makefile b/testasmcomp/Makefile
index 4034752dc..ba798f01c 100644
--- a/testasmcomp/Makefile
+++ b/testasmcomp/Makefile
@@ -22,6 +22,7 @@ INCLUDES=-I ../utils -I ../typing -I ../asmcomp
OTHEROBJS=../utils/misc.cmo ../utils/tbl.cmo \
../utils/clflags.cmo ../utils/config.cmo \
+ ../parsing/location.cmo \
../typing/ident.cmo ../typing/path.cmo ../typing/subst.cmo \
../typing/predef.cmo ../typing/env.cmo \
../bytecomp/lambda.cmo \
diff --git a/testasmcomp/alpha.asm b/testasmcomp/alpha.asm
index 4df83456e..9384609de 100644
--- a/testasmcomp/alpha.asm
+++ b/testasmcomp/alpha.asm
@@ -37,11 +37,8 @@ call_gen_code:
caml_c_call:
lda $sp, -16($sp)
stq $26, 0($sp)
- stq $gp, 8($sp)
- mov $25, $27
- jsr ($25)
+ jsr ($27)
ldq $26, 0($sp)
- ldq $gp, 8($sp)
lda $sp, 16($sp)
ret ($26)